# Greetings from The On-Line Encyclopedia of Integer Sequences! http://oeis.org/ Search: id:a141115 Showing 1-1 of 1 %I A141115 #14 Mar 07 2021 03:17:35 %S A141115 18,30,42,50,54,66,70,78,98,102,110,114,130,138,140,154,160,162,170, %T A141115 174,182,186,190,200,220,222,224,230,238,242,246,250,258,260,266,282, %U A141115 286,290,308,310,315,318,322,338,340,350,352,354,364,366,370,374,380,392 %N A141115 Those positive integers k where both d(d(k)) is not coprime to k and d(d(k)) does not divide k, where d(k) is the number of divisors of k. %H A141115 Amiram Eldar, Table of n, a(n) for n = 1..10000 %e A141115 50 has 6 divisors and 6 has 4 divisors. 4 is not coprime to 50 and 4 does not divide 50. So 50 is in the sequence. %t A141115 Select[Range[400], GCD[DivisorSigma[0,DivisorSigma[0, # ]], # ] > 1 && Mod[ #, DivisorSigma[0, DivisorSigma[0, # ]]] > 0 &] (* _Stefan Steinerberger_, Jun 05 2008 *) %Y A141115 Cf.
